Runbook: Scanline barcode bridge

If warehouse scans stop flowing into Cartwheel, it's almost always the bridge service on the Dunmore floor box wedging after a USB hiccup. Bounce the service first — nine times out of ten that fixes it. If not, check the queue depth before escalating. When restarting, make sure the bridge comes up with these settings.

deployment values, yafop-bajef:
[gilok]
team = ulaius
access_code = ac_423664
host = gilok.sivrelhq.corp
port = 9200
owner = pelius.istax
peer = eliok.torvasoft.internal

Document Transport — Archiving Paper Ledgers. This page covers the quarterly transfer of retired paper ledgers from the Thornbeck branch to the Gravelane archive vault. Coordinator responsibilities: verify each ledger box is strapped, labelled with the archive run number, and recorded on the transfer manifest before the driver departs. Boxes must never travel unsealed or mixed with general post. For the vault hand-over, the driver must follow this confidential instruction:

dispatch memo: the lamwyn fenwyn courier leaves the wenir ledger at gate 7175 under passcode 822969

Handover — Fenwick Autocomplete

Welcome aboard. Main open issue: the autocomplete index on Fenwick is slow under load, p95 around 800ms. Root cause is the index rebuilding synchronously on every bulk import; we've mitigated by throttling imports to off-peak hours. A proper fix means moving rebuilds to the async worker — half-finished branch exists, ask me before touching it. Monitoring lives in the standard dashboard. Query logs rotate daily. The service reads its tuning parameters at startup, and the current values are listed here.

config for bawig-fadup:
[zorix]
host = zorix.lumicworks.corp
user = zorix_svc
database = zorix_prod

# Crumbline plugin env — read before editing.
# Order cutoff is enforced server-side: orders placed after
# CUTOFF_HOUR=14 roll to the next bake day. Plugins must not
# override this locally. To validate cutoff webhooks from the
# Crumbline core, your plugin needs the shared signing secret,
# which goes on the line directly below:

secret setting of yajog-taguf: ARCHIVE_KEY3=051